About IPSD

Caterpillar’s Industrial Power Systems Division (IPSD) designs, tests and manufactures 0.5 to 18L engines that not only power Caterpillar machines, but also power over 5000 other applications including Marine, Petroleum, Industrial Applications, Electric Generators, and Locomotives. Caterpillar’s company strategy includes sustainability as one of four focus areas and IPSD is engaged and actively preparing green energy solutions for the future.

About Caterpillar

Caterpillar Inc. is the world’s leading manufacturer of construction and mining equipment, off-highway diesel and natural gas engines, industrial gas turbines and diesel-electric locomotives.
